What is the median home price in Bucyrus?

The median home value in Bucyrus is $125k. The median monthly rent is $772. Annual property taxes average $2k. Home values are based on U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ey estimates.

Are home values rising in Bucyrus?

Home values in Bucyrus have increased 13.8% over the past two years. This indicates a strong appreciation trend. This data is sourced from the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index.

How much income do you need to buy a home in Bucyrus?

Based on a typical all-in ownership cost of $767/month (mortgage, taxes, insurance), you'd generally need a household income of approximately $33k/year to keep housing costs at or below 28% of gross income — a common lender guideline. The median household income in Bucyrus is $54k/year.

What industries drive the economy in Bucyrus?

The largest employment sectors in Bucyrus are retail (30%) and public administration (17%) of the local workforce. Industry data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ey.
